Skip to content

Commit 827d0fa

Browse files
Fix: Add -e flag to uv pip install commands for local package development
Co-Authored-By: [email protected] <[email protected]>
1 parent 32e2fce commit 827d0fa

File tree

1 file changed

+3
-3
lines changed

1 file changed

+3
-3
lines changed

.github/workflows/python-ci.yml

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-45,7 +45,7 @@ jobs:
4545
else
4646
. ../../.venv/bin/activate
4747
fi
48-
uv pip install -r requirements.txt -r dev-requirements.txt
48+
uv pip install -e . -r requirements.txt -r dev-requirements.txt
4949
5050
- name: selfie-lib - pytest
5151
shell: bash
@@ -89,7 +89,7 @@ jobs:
8989
else
9090
. ../../.venv/bin/activate
9191
fi
92-
uv pip install -r requirements.txt -r dev-requirements.txt
92+
uv pip install -e . -r requirements.txt -r dev-requirements.txt
9393
9494
- name: pytest-selfie - pyright
9595
shell: bash
@@ -122,7 +122,7 @@ jobs:
122122
else
123123
. ../../.venv/bin/activate
124124
fi
125-
uv pip install -r requirements.txt -r dev-requirements.txt
125+
uv pip install -e . -r requirements.txt -r dev-requirements.txt
126126
127127
- name: example-pytest-selfie - pytest
128128
shell: bash

0 commit comments

Comments
 (0)